SQL删除重复数据的方法
发表于:2025-01-21 作者:千家信息网编辑
千家信息网最后更新 2025年01月21日,这篇文章将为大家详细讲解有关SQL删除重复数据的方法,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。在sql中,可以使用select语句删除重复数据,语法为:"sel
千家信息网最后更新 2025年01月21日SQL删除重复数据的方法
这篇文章将为大家详细讲解有关SQL删除重复数据的方法,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。
在sql中,可以使用select语句删除重复数据,语法为:"select * from 字段 where 字段id in (select 字段id from 字段 group by 字段 having count(字段id) > 1)"。
本教程操作环境:windows7系统、mysql8.0版本、Dell G3电脑。
用SQL语句,删除掉重复项只保留一条
在几千条记录里,存在着些相同的记录,如何能用SQL语句,删除掉重复的呢
查找表中多余的重复记录,重复记录是根据单个字段(peopleId)来判断
select * from people where peopleId in (select peopleId from people group by peopleId having count(peopleId) > 1)
扩展:
删除表中多余的重复记录,重复记录是根据单个字段(peopleId)来判断,只留有rowid最小的记录
delete from peoplewhere peopleName in (select peopleName from people group by peopleName having count(peopleName) > 1)and peopleId not in (select min(peopleId) from people group by peopleName having count(peopleName)>1)
查找表中多余的重复记录(多个字段)
select * from vitae awhere (a.peopleId,a.seq) in (select peopleId,seq from vitae group by peopleId,seq having count(*) > 1)
删除表中多余的重复记录(多个字段),只留有rowid最小的记录
delete from vitae awhere (a.peopleId,a.seq) in (select peopleId,seq from vitae group by peopleId,seq having count(*) > 1)and rowid not in (select min(rowid) from vitae group by peopleId,seq having count(*)>1)
查找表中多余的重复记录(多个字段),不包含rowid最小的记录
select * from vitae awhere (a.peopleId,a.seq) in (select peopleId,seq from vitae group by peopleId,seq having count(*) > 1)and rowid not in (select min(rowid) from vitae group by peopleId,seq having count(*)>1)
消除一个字段的左边的第一位:
update tableName set [Title]=Right([Title],(len([Title])-1)) where Title like '村%'
消除一个字段的右边的第一位:
update tableName set [Title]=left([Title],(len([Title])-1)) where Title like '%村'
假删除表中多余的重复记录(多个字段),不包含rowid最小的记录
update vitae set ispass=-1where peopleId in (select peopleId from vitae group by peopleId
关于"SQL删除重复数据的方法"这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,使各位可以学到更多知识,如果觉得文章不错,请把它分享出去让更多的人看到。
字段
最小
多个
数据
篇文章
语句
方法
单个
更多
不错
实用
相同
内容
右边
教程
文章
版本
环境
电脑
知识
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
cdn 服务器缓存
网络技术证书培训机构
国际通用的数据库证
2018网络安全10件大事
信息技术公司网络安全
口碑最好的服务器电脑
服务器管理没有群集
服务器提交了协议冲突
原子云服务器怎么选版本
某翻译软件开发
一个软件开发公司有什么职位
微信小程序免费服务器
自动炒股软件开发
接口表和数据库表的区别
湖北通用软件开发零售价格
网络安全保护等级相关内容
无法连接SAS服务器
软件开发分享
内蒙古数据中心服务器
陕西西安大唐网络技术有限公司
云服务器起的适用范围
影之刃3选什么服务器
数据库原理严冬梅答案
微信服务器在美国手中
女32转行做软件开发
常用pc软件开发
怀旧服联盟服务器推荐2022
ip地址数据库 sql
弹弹岛怎么查玩过的服务器
网络安全利与弊活动内容